Output 768eeef17f700eddef97cbae4aa109e3ee4b91141ff6cf428db74fc55fee104f:0

value
8076285
script pubkey
OP_0 OP_PUSHBYTES_20 2909e0fe015ae41d0a284409edfdc81f947704cc
address
bc1q9yy7plspttjp6z3ggsy7mlwgr728wpxv9peg2r
transaction
768eeef17f700eddef97cbae4aa109e3ee4b91141ff6cf428db74fc55fee104f
confirmations
20568
spent
false